Content Description From the Collection: This collection primarily contains Civil War-era letters from William Hogan to his wife, Lucinda, from 1862 to 1864. In addition to the letters, there is a single, undated, photograph of three family members, Lucinda James and Mollie Hogan. Letters between William and Lucinda discuss Confederate camp life, operations on the Hogan family’s farm in McDowell County, North Carolina, William’s participation in the Battles of Antietam and Fredericksburg, observations of Virginia and North...
